      Fix unlocking function for most Atmel AT2[56]D* chips · cecb2c56
      Stefan Tauner authored
      I broke unlocking them correctly in r1635 while refactoring (NB: the
      commit log including the overly selfconfident statement about the
      "bug in spi_disable_blockprotect_at25df()").
      
      Affected chips have per sector protection bits and the write protection bits
      in the status register do indicate if none, some or all sectors are protected.
      It is possible to globally (un)lock all sectors at once but in a way that was
      not anticipated when refactoring the spi25 unlocking functions into
      spi_disable_blockprotect_generic(). To globally unprotect not only the
      protection bits (2 and 3) have 0 to be written to them but also bits 4 and 5
      which normally would not be touched by spi_disable_blockprotect_generic().
      Some of the chips also support a permanent lockdown with fuses which we
      do not handle yet.
      
      To fix this without copying the whole method I introduce another mask
      parameter to spi_disable_blockprotect_generic() namely unprotect_mask.
      See verbose comments inline...

      Fix evil twins of Macronix MX25L1605, MX25L3205, MX25L6405 · 226037da
      Stefan Tauner authored
      Similarly to the patch in r1647 this one updates the chips identified as above
      with references to and data about their respective twins. Unlike previously this
      one deals with the more evil details.
      
      Helge Wagner from GE discovered some problems with chips sharing IDs
      and proposed a patch to tackle (some of) them, see:
      http://patchwork.coreboot.org/patch/3709/
      That patch was bitrotting in our mailboxes for a long time and it is still not
      ready for merge, but we increasingly get reports about problems (e.g.
      http://paste.flashrom.org/view.php?id=1525) regarding these chips and
      hence must act to ensure users' safety.
      
      This patch splits the chip definitions of evil twins into separate ones which
      correctly declare the respective attributes (the main problems are the erase
      block sizes for the 0x20 opcode and hence my changes combine different
      chips with partly different attributes apart from their names as long as the
      erasers layout it the same). This fo...

      Fix building for MacOSX · e038e908
      Stefan Tauner authored
      
      - Add a new macro named IS_MACOSX to hwaccess.c and use it to enable iopl().
        This was broken since r1638. This fix does *not* restore the very permissive
        concept where iopl() was activated in an #else branch that was inplace before
        r1638.
      - Make printing the image file's size in flashrom.c platform independent.
      
      Bonus: remove definitions of off64_t and lseek64 which are not necessary
      anymore for about 1000 commits.
      
      Thanks to SJ for reporting the issue and testing the solution.
